Output 711098e13054c707f494c850fa920966a3cacb3bd58e6376a0dbe30de8580139:0

value
17218641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b581cf9a725bf076b2cdc671f4a1706a7b06bd0b OP_EQUAL
address
3JEjjgrjqsF3r4yFRsEtcqg9joD92K6MJU
transaction
711098e13054c707f494c850fa920966a3cacb3bd58e6376a0dbe30de8580139
spent
true